standard height in u.s. is 6 foot 8 inches = 203.2 cm = 2.032 m
A typical front entry door is a 3'0 x 6'8". So 36" wide by 80" tall.
The average front door is 36in. or 3 feet. ADA standards require at least 32 inches for handicapped access.

The purpose of a doormat is to be placed in front of a door in order to limit the amount of dirt and debris that is tracked into the house. There are doormats that can be placed on the outside of the door as well as the inside of the door.

Weather stripping on the front door can be replaced by first removing all of the old weather stripping. Then new weather stripping can be put in place using a type that has a sticky side to adhere to the door frame. The weather stripping should be placed on the closest area to the outside lip of the door frame.
